1. Schedule a Roof Inspection Before Storm Season

Your roof is your home’s first line of defense. If it’s already compromised — even slightly — you’re at high risk for Texas hail roof damage.

🔍 Look for signs like:

  • Missing or curling shingles

  • Granule loss

  • Leaks or ceiling stains

  • Flashing that’s rusted or bent

2. Upgrade to Stormproof Siding

Siding replacement isn’t just about curb appeal — it’s about creating a shield for your home. Many older homes in Central Texas still have builder-grade vinyl siding, which cracks and buckles easily under storm stress.

🏆 Our recommendation?
James Hardie fiber cement siding — it’s resistant to hail impact, won’t warp in heat or humidity, and it’s non-combustible. Plus, it holds paint up to 3x longer than wood or vinyl.

3. Check and Reinforce Windows

Broken windows during a storm are more than a mess — they’re a major hazard and can lead to extensive interior water damage.

✅ Be on the lookout for:

  • Cracked glass or failing seals

  • Outdated single-pane designs

  • Stiff operation or loose locking mechanisms

Upgrading to modern, impact-rated window replacement helps keep wind and debris out while also improving insulation and energy savings.

4. Seal and Caulk the Gaps

Tiny openings can lead to big problems during a storm. Water intrusion from small cracks can weaken your structure over time and contribute to mold growth.

🧰 Inspect these areas:

  • Around windows and doors

  • Under eaves and overhangs

  • Foundation transitions

  • Utility penetrations

Recaulking or sealing these gaps is a small job that provides major home weather protection.

5. Clean Your Gutters and Downspouts

Backed-up gutters don’t just cause water overflow — they can direct runoff into your home’s walls or foundation.

🌀 Before storm season:

  • Remove leaves, twigs, and debris

  • Check for sagging or leaks

  • Ensure downspouts direct water away from the house

A functioning gutter system helps preserve both your siding and roofing systems during heavy Texas downpours.

6. Trim Trees and Secure Outdoor Items

Loose limbs and unsecured furniture are among the top causes of storm damage during high winds.

🌳 Before the first major thunderstorm:

  • Cut back any limbs hanging near your roof

  • Remove dead trees

  • Tie down patio furniture, grills, and yard equipment

It’s all about reducing potential projectiles that could damage your roof, siding, or windows.
